In this behind-the-scenes video, meet Dartmoor shepherd Russell Ashford, Fern the fabulous sheepdog, and the film’s creators: purpleSTARS!
purpleSTARS brings together artists and technologists with and without learning difficulties or disabilities to transform museum experiences and make them truly inclusive. purpleSTARS was commissioned by the Earley Charity to design interactive exhibits for The MERL. This included a quad bike that visitors can sit on whilst wearing a virtual reality headset, enabling you to truly see what’s it like to be a modern-day shepherd today.
purpleSTARS was created following ‘Sensory Objects’, a project which worked with people with learning disabilities as co-researchers, with researchers from the University of Reading departments of Art, Biomedical Engineering and RIX Research and Media at the University of East London, making museum interpretation together through a series of sensory art and electronics workshops.
